Hello, the same problem exists for the German DBpedia [1]. The general problem is that English URIs are used and only data is included, if a matching English article is produced. We are currently working on making the code language independent. i.e. the French MediaWiki category namespace is probably not 'Category:' but 'Catégories:' encoded: Cat%E9gories:, so once we have that sorted out, there will be more language specific versions. We are currently still optimizing the live extraction, after that this is the next on the list. If you are really interested, you might help us and try to run the extraction yourself and see what faulty data it produces. Checkout [2] and configure and run extract_test.php with the article category extractor. You can already configure, that uri should look like http://fr.dbpedia.org/Paris in config/dbpedia-dist.ini (copy to dbpedia.ini and compare with dbpedia_default.ini) But it is still a long way to go.
